description Post-processed CESM output of the simulations used for the results of the 2023 paper in Climate of the Past: 'Resilient Antarctic monsoonal climate prevented ice growth during the Eocene' Each subfolder contains average and climatology fields of selected atmospheric variables, based on the last 100 years of the respective simulation. Oceanic fields are also provided for the 3 core simulations: 38Ma 4xPIC, 38Ma 2xPIC, Pre-ind ref. Check the 'Simulations overview' for a list, naming convention, and basic information of the simulations.
